Abstract

Official abstract text for this publication.

Systems and methods for formatting frames in neighborhood aware networks are described herein. One aspect of the subject matter described in the disclosure provides a method of communicating in a wireless neighborhood aware network (NAN). The method includes determining a discovery period. The method further includes generating a discovery window information element indicating a start time of a discovery window. The method further includes generating a NAN beacon or other sync frame comprising the discovery period and the discovery window information element. The method further includes transmitting, at a wireless device, the NAN beacon or other sync frame during the discovery window.

What is claimed is: 1. A method of communicating in a wireless neighborhood aware network (NAN), comprising: determining, by a wireless device, a discovery period, the discovery period including a discovery window and indicating a duration of time from a start of the discovery window to a start of a subsequent discovery window; generating, by the wireless device, a NAN beacon or other sync frame comprising a discovery period field indicating the discovery period, a field indicating a start time of the discovery window in relation to the discovery period, a destination address field that includes a broadcast address, a network address field that includes a NAN BSSID of the NAN, independent of an address of the wireless device and an information element comprising a time synchronization function (TSF) indicating a time of a subsequent discovery period; and transmitting, by the wireless device, the NAN beacon or other sync frame during the discovery window. 2.
